Best Uses I Recommend

From my point of view, this insulated lining works best for:

  • Pot holders
  • Oven mitts
  • Lunch totes
  • Casserole carriers
  • Fabric baskets
  • Mug rugs
  • Travel food covers

I find it especially useful when I want a project to keep food warm or cool for a longer time.

Tips I Follow When Using It

When I work with insulated lining, I take my time cutting and pinning so the layers stay aligned. I also prefer to follow the sewing instructions closely, especially if the lining has a special reflective side or a specific direction it should face. That helps me get the best performance from the finished item.
